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A)

Behavior analysis focuses on the principles that explain how learning takes place.

class image

What is ABA?

ABA therapy for children with autism focuses on increasing desired, socially significant behaviors and decreasing behaviors that can be dangerous or interfere with learning. At Amigo Care, we incorporate ABA strategies and principles in a naturalistic, play based format. We believe that children learn best when they are motivated and having fun.
class image

What is the goal of ABA?

The goal is to promote appropriate behaviors and discourage inappropriate behaviors. ABA therapy has a scientifically proven track record for success in helping children with autism in the following skill domains: language and communicaiton, socialization, activitities of daily living, and adaptability.
class image

What can I expect?

You and your child will work with a therapy team that includes a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A), who has undergone extensive training in ABA and a therapist or Registered Behavior Technician (RBT). Therapists meet with the children one-on-one, in the child’s home, in a safe and familiar environment that helps the child learn. It also allows the therapy team to work in close contact with the rest of the child’s family and incorporate them into the therapy program for a Whole Family Approach.

Skills We Work On

Maladaptive Behavior Reduction

We apply ABA therapy methods to promote positive behaviors and help get your child back on track.

Increase Communication

We teach your child how to make their needs known. This is an important part of the ABA therapy process.

Social skills

Our team uses ABA therapy to help children with autism learn valuable skills that encourage them to better integrate socially.

Self-Help Skills

Simple things are hard for children with ASD. ABA therapy helps them manage daily life by teaching them functional skills like dressing and/or bathing.

Tolerance Training

We teach your child how to increase the amount of time they will need to wait in order to access someone's attention or to obtain access to an item or activity.

Early Intervention

We provide early intervention services based on ABA principles in a naturalistic, play based format. Children learn best when they are motivated and having fun!
